将excel表导入到mysql中

Posted Xiao|Deng

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了将excel表导入到mysql中相关的知识,希望对你有一定的参考价值。

//导入excel表


方法一:
1)打开Excel另存为CSV文件
2)将文件编码转化为utf8,用NotePad++打开csv文件,选择格式—转为utf8编码格式—保存
2)在mysql建表,字段的顺序要跟Excel保持一致
3load data local infile \'[你的csv文件路径]\' into table [表名] fields terminated by \',\';
例如:
load data local infile \'E:\\\\1.csv\' into table gift_list fields terminated by \',\';
注意:
3.1)csv文件的分隔符是逗号,所以最后terminated by之后跟的是逗号。
3.2)如果是制表符,则用 \'\\t\',这一步记得查看log,必须没有warning才算成功。
3.3)若无法确定字段之间是制表符还是逗号,导入一次看导入的结果就明白了
参考链接:http://www.cnblogs.com/latifrons/archive/2012/09/07/2675141.html

方法二:
打开表的data界面,选择 "import data" 即可开始导入文件的流程

 

以上是关于将excel表导入到mysql中的主要内容,如果未能解决你的问题,请参考以下文章

sql根据某一个字段重复只取第一条数据

Python实现MySQL数据库连接---pymysql

Mysql将Excel表导入至Mysql的当中一张表

实测:向MySql数据库导入excel表数据

MYSQL怎么批量导入多个excel文件,字段都是对应的

如何将Excel导入到Mysql数据库中